Hexyldecyl Isostearate

INCI: HEXYLDECYL ISOSTEARATE

CAS Number
69247-84-3
Function
Skin conditioning — emollient (branched alkyl ester)
Safety Rating
GOOD

Regulatory Status

🇪🇺 EU Status permitted
🇺🇸 US Status permitted
US Notes Permitted — included in CIR alkyl esters group assessment (238 ingredients); concluded safe as used

Safety Data

Margin of Safety (MoS)
adequate
Dermal Absorption
low
Sensitization
low
